I live in mixed forest wetland near the Pacific Ocean. I have an urban standard lot. I aquired it 4 years ago. It was overgrown with blackberry, pompous grass, ornamental flax. I hired a woman from the local Native Nursery to do an assessment and make recommendations. I removed many nonnative invasive plants. I have planted many new native plants specific for this regions. I have install a pollinator strip in the sunny front area and promote pollinator gardening to my neighbors.
